Output 24924e16cbf634e781e9986e6a191a6d28a6afa14d3db94a3491e876597b57a7:0

value
44531642
script pubkey
OP_0 OP_PUSHBYTES_20 343ff75586ebad72d26efa6c7cec61f57cccac35
address
bc1qxsllw4vxawkh95nwlfk8emrp747vetp4fv92ny
transaction
24924e16cbf634e781e9986e6a191a6d28a6afa14d3db94a3491e876597b57a7
confirmations
26119
spent
true